Output ea6f91c79972709e971db77e142b6324131698f7816eba265538dae57b3eac9b:33

value
3369988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c736a83685797a0c8eee14ca06d06a0dfa1c61 OP_EQUAL
address
3MufuXzhVNCPcKHV425zQpn3PX7uhUKjfL
transaction
ea6f91c79972709e971db77e142b6324131698f7816eba265538dae57b3eac9b
spent
true